I have been looking to do a fixed amsteel bridge on my kestrel and have seen G2's video which is great. For the life of me, I can't figure out how you do a locked brummel on the other bridge attachment point after being already connected to the other? Thanks for any insight

If you continue into G2’s video (which was great) he will show how to do this. Basically, once you add the locked Brummell on one side of your saddle, which is what is sounds like you are doing, you then need to feed the other side (not a locked Brummell) then sew it so the bury won’t come loose.
